Data analytics for enhanced hearing health

Project description

This project aims to consolidate hearing health data with other datasets to unlock valuable insights and drive personalised hearing healthcare interventions. The expected outcomes are to streamline access to hearing health data, improve data connectivity, and enhance treatment outcomes. The potential benefit is to facilitate informed decision-making for healthcare providers to enable better patient care.

Ideal student skillsetTertiary qualifications or demonstrated relevant, equivalent professional experience in medicine, health sciences, public health, psychology or a related discipline.

Proficient use and knowledge of a wide range of statistical and mathematical platforms including: SPSS, R, MATLAB, Mplus, Excel, NLogit, SAS, Python.

Experience in statistical tests ranging from parametric to non-parametric methods, linear and nonlinear methods and machine learning strategies.

Strong time and project management skills and can work in a team environment.

Multidisciplinary in their approach and with an ability to apply skills and experience to various fields.

Fluency in SQL, data modelling and database design is desirable.
